Manufacturer’s Liability Versus Driver’s Responsibility

In the context of autonomous vehicle law, determining liability involves assessing whether the manufacturer or the driver bears responsibility for an incident. Unlike traditional vehicles, autonomous vehicles shift some of this responsibility due to their automated systems.

Manufacturers may be held liable if software malfunctions, hardware failures, or design defects directly contribute to an accident. These cases often invoke product liability principles, where the manufacturer is responsible for ensuring safety and reliability.

Conversely, if an incident results from improper maintenance, misuse, or failed intervention by the driver, liability may shift to the individual behind the wheel. This is especially relevant if the autonomous features require driver oversight or manual control at any point.

Legal distinctions hinge on the degree of automation and the specific circumstances of each incident. Current laws are evolving to clearly allocate responsibility, balancing manufacturer accountability with driver oversight in the emerging landscape of autonomous vehicles and insurance claims.

Insurance Claim Process for Autonomous Vehicle Accidents

The process of filing an insurance claim for autonomous vehicle accidents involves several systematic steps. Initially, the involved party must notify their insurance provider promptly, providing detailed accident information and relevant documentation. This includes accident reports, photographs, and possible evidence from the vehicle’s data logs.

Insurance companies typically conduct an investigation to determine liability, which may involve examining data from the autonomous vehicle’s software systems, hardware diagnostics, and any third-party evidence. Due to the complex nature of autonomous vehicle technology, insurers often rely on technical experts for liability assessments.

Contingent upon the investigation’s findings, the insurer will evaluate the claim relative to the policy coverage, considering factors such as fault, software or hardware failures, and applicable laws. If the claim is approved, the insurer proceeds with indemnification, covering repair costs or liability payments, depending on the case specifics.

As autonomous vehicle technology advances, the claim process may evolve to incorporate new legal standards, making clarity and thorough documentation critical for a smooth resolution.

Impact of Autonomous Vehicles on Insurance Premiums and Coverage

The advent of autonomous vehicles significantly influences insurance premiums and coverage by altering risk assessment strategies. Insurers are increasingly considering predictive analytics and data from vehicle systems to determine policies, potentially leading to more accurate pricing.

With autonomous vehicle technology reducing human error, some models suggest a decline in accident frequency, which could result in lower insurance premiums over time. However, the complexity of autonomous systems introduces new liability concerns, possibly offsetting premium decreases due to higher repair costs or software vulnerabilities.

Insurance providers are also adapting their coverage policies to address unique risks associated with autonomous vehicles, such as cybersecurity threats or hardware failures. As the sector evolves, insurers may develop specialized policies tailored specifically to autonomous vehicle owners, reflecting the changing landscape of risk.

Changes in Policy Coverage for Autonomous Vehicles

The evolution of autonomous vehicles has prompted significant updates to insurance policy coverage. These changes aim to reflect the unique risks and responsibilities associated with autonomous technology. Insurers are now developing tailored policies that address specific autonomous vehicle features.

  1. Policy coverage now often includes cyber risks related to software malfunctions or hacking attempts on autonomous systems. These risks were less prominent in traditional vehicle insurance but are vital for autonomous vehicle protection.

  2. Coverage options are expanding to encompass hardware failures, sensor malfunctions, and data breaches. Insurers recognize these factors as critical components influencing the safety and liability of autonomous vehicle operations.

  3. Some providers are adjusting premium structures and policy limits based on vehicle autonomy levels, driving behaviors, and safety features. These modifications are intended to accurately reflect the evolving risk landscape and encourage safer automation practices.
